Output 758d93c1aec8b6852b639133be869b0d653b9522aadaac5a291a6b14bac8f864:0

value
580100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55d1bedb2679c84656a60d4ea65111f34818453f OP_EQUAL
address
39WndDxyskdKuKM8wxpUEEu6K2mZzfzzig
transaction
758d93c1aec8b6852b639133be869b0d653b9522aadaac5a291a6b14bac8f864
confirmations
312038
spent
true